The Role:
This person will conduct Analytical and Sensory analysis & reporting, product analysis and calibrations to contribute to the creation of innovative products and provide support for existing products.
You will:
- Sample preparation, organisation, and management of samples.
- Punctually attend and actively participate in planning or team meetings.
- Complete assigned tasks with speed, accuracy and using safe work procedures and approved analytical methods.
- Operate, maintain, and clean laboratory equipment using safe work and approved procedures.
- Adhere to Conditions of Entry to Analytical Laboratory and Pilot Plant.
- Maintain lab quality systems by focusing on continuous improvement in service and interaction with other departments/clients.
- Order required consumables.
- Conduct Job Safety Analysis (JSA) and assist in the development and review of Safe Work
- Procedures (SWP) with supervision.
Skills & Experience:
- Relevant TAFE qualifications in Science, Food Technology, or related science area, or equivalent.
- Current Australian Driver’s License.
- Experience in food manufacturing and analytical laboratory environments an advantage
- Knowledge of WHS and EEO in the workplace.
- Basic food regulations, legislation, and food safety.
- Basic understanding of ISO and NATA principles and requirements as applies to food analysis
- Customer focus and team orientation.
- Work independently, under supervision or in a team as needed.
- Good interpersonal and communication skills both written and verbal.
- Safe operating procedures for pilot plant environment or laboratory
- Personal organisation and time management skills.
